What to draw on a birthday card step by step


Here's a step-by-step guide on what to draw on a birthday card:

**Step 1: Choose a Theme**
Think about the person's interests, hobbies, or personality traits. You can also consider the occasion and the relationship you have with the birthday person. For example:
* If it's a friend's birthday, you could draw something lighthearted like a cartoon animal or a funny scene.
* If it's a family member's birthday, you might draw something more sentimental like a heartwarming scene or a personalized message.

**Step 2: Sketch the Main Element**
Start by sketching the main element of your drawing. This could be:
* A person (e.g., a smiling face, a party hat, or a celebratory pose)
* An animal (e.g., a cute cartoon creature, a dog with a party hat, or a cat playing with confetti)
* An object (e.g., a cake with candles, balloons, or a gift box)

**Step 3: Add Supporting Elements**
Add some supporting elements to enhance your drawing and make it more visually appealing:
* Confetti, balloons, or streamers to create a festive atmosphere
* A background that complements the main element (e.g., a birthday cake on a colorful tablecloth)
* Additional details like eyes, mouth, or accessories to give your drawing personality

**Step 4: Add Text and Messages**
Don't forget to include a heartfelt message inside the card! You can write:
* A simple "Happy Birthday" with the birthday person's name
* A personalized message expressing your feelings (e.g., "You're an amazing friend!")
* A funny joke or pun related to birthdays

**Step 5: Keep it Simple and Elegant**
Remember, the goal is to create a cute and thoughtful drawing that complements the occasion. Don't worry too much about artistic perfection – simple and elegant can be just as effective!
